Short Course: Introduction to Statistics in Pharmacovigilance

This is a Virtual Pre-Conference Short Course in conjunction with the Global Pharmacovigilance and Risk Management Strategies Conference

概览

*Short Courses require an additional registration fee. You do not need to be registered for the forum to attend*

 

This (mainly) formula-free half day course will provide a basic introduction to statistics and probability which will be applied in the context of drug safety.

 

Topics to be covered include: Understanding denominators and numerators; Measuring and presenting risk; Comparing risks: introduction to absolute risk, risk ratios, odds ratios, and hazard ratios – when, why, and what to look for; Understanding variability, confidence intervals, p-values, and significance; Meta-analysis vs. pooled analysis; Common statistics abuses in PV

      Agenda

      • Session 1: The context of statistics in PV (45 minutes)
      • Break (15 minutes)
      • Session 2: Understanding Variability (45 minutes)
      • Break (30 minutes)
      • Session 3:Evidence and Interpretation, Systematic reviews, Meta-analysis (45 minutes)
      • Break (15 minutes)
      • Use and abuse of statistics in PV (45 minutes)

      学习目标

      Upon completing this course, attendees will be able to:
      • Explain the importance of denominators and numerators
      • Identify common approaches to measuring and presenting risk
      • Describe standard methods of comparing risks, including absolute risk, risk ratios, odds ratios, and hazard ratios – when, why, and what to look for
      • Analyze the concepts of variability, confidence intervals, p-values, and statistical significance
      • Compare Meta-analysis vs. pooled analysis
      • Recognize common statistics abuses in PV
